The Confessions of a Joy Stealer
I am the judge of how happy you should be
I'll not allow you to be as happy as me.
I take great pleasure in denying you your emotional treasure
I feel exuberation when I ruin your celebration
When you feel glad, I like making you sad.
For I had to be bad to be noticed, so says Otis.
And how do you stop a joy stealer you ask?
As you know, that is not a simple task.
For many joy stealers are members of your family,
from whom you can not run, can not hide and can not flee
So my advice to you to say, the next time someone tries to steal your joy away,
"The joys of life are far and few.
I'd rather keep my joy and be rid of you.
So do not stay. Go away.
Maybe I'll talk to you another day.
And then maybe I won't."
